I'm just wondering is Durant ever manufactured this model? I'm interested in purchasing this car which is labeled Durant Boat Tail Speedster but haven't been able to locate any information on this car.
Sean;
There are others more knowledgeable than me in the club and maybe they will chime in. As far as I know Durant never made a boat tail car. Probably what you have is someone who took a touring car and due to the damage or rust in the back end, created the boat tail speedster look. If you could get the data plate information off the cowl it will tell you where the car was made and should tell you the original model type.
Mike like you said there is nothing to say we ever built a boat tail speedster. There were co's that you could buy those bodies from or make one up on your own.
Not sure what car Sean refers to. I did see pics of one long ago up the Quebec side of the Ottawa River, but it was just a home made thing. If Sean is referring to eBay 121570495644 not much left of the orig car other than the vin plate saying it was a 1928 M2 E 14991 made in Elizabeth plant. This has been on eBay before. This also is a home made toy and perhaps the frame, crest, cut front bumper, rear bumperette's and vin plate is all that remains of a sedan / coupe.
